当使用 chkconfig iptables on 时可能会报出这样的错:
error reading information on service iptables: No such file or directory
记录一下解决方案:
首先关闭防火墙服务
systemctl stop firewalld
systemctl mask firewalld
之后安装iptables-services package
yum install iptables-services
将给服务设为开机启动
systemctl enable iptables
该服务相关命令
systemctl [stop|start|restart] iptables
修改开放端口
先执行
service iptables save
之后再
vim /etc/sysconfig/iptables
最后重启防火墙
service iptables restart
参考:http://stackoverflow.com/questions/24756240/how-can-i-use-iptables-on-centos-7